Window Tinting in Plano, TX
Window tinting shapes how a vehicle or property performs against sun, heat, and glare every day. A quality tint installation reduces cabin temperatures during Texas summers, cuts glare that fatigues drivers, protects interiors from UV damage, and adds a layer of privacy that both drivers and homeowners appreciate. In Plano, where daytime temperatures push into the triple digits for weeks at a stretch, the right window tint is less of a luxury and more of a practical everyday upgrade. Whether the vehicle is a daily driver, a work truck, a classic car being preserved, or a fleet unit that spends full days on the road, quality window tinting extends the life of the interior and improves the experience of everyone who uses it.
Poor tint work shows itself within a season. Bubbling, peeling, purple discoloration, and uneven cuts all trace back to shortcuts on film choice, surface preparation, or installer skill. Professional installation uses high-quality films, careful surface prep, and precise cutting so the finished result looks factory-installed and holds up under years of sun and heat. Cheap tint often costs more in the long run when it has to be removed and redone. Skilled tint installers also spend more time on surface prep than most customers ever notice, since the difference between a bubble-free finish and a peeling failure often comes down to how carefully the glass was cleaned and inspected before the film was cut.

About Plano, TX
Plano is a large, family-focused city in Collin County, Texas, set in the northern part of the Dallas-Fort Worth metroplex. The community grew from a small farming town into one of the largest cities in Texas, and today it blends established residential neighborhoods, master-planned communities, thriving corporate campuses, and lively retail and entertainment districts.
Everyday life leans on family, food, and community. Legacy West and the Shops at Legacy anchor upscale shopping, dining, and nightlife, while Historic Downtown Plano offers restaurants, breweries, and small-town charm just blocks from the modern city center. Restaurants across town serve everything from Tex-Mex and barbecue to Korean, Indian, Vietnamese, and modern American plates that reflect the community's diversity. Longtime residents and newcomers alike find plenty of ways to enjoy the seasons here.
Community events shape the calendar year after year. The Plano Balloon Festival draws crowds every fall for hot air balloons, live music, and food, and the Downtown Plano Arts Festival, Fourth of July fireworks, and seasonal farmers markets keep the community connected across every season.
Sun Exposure and Privacy Needs That Drive Window Tinting
Texas sun drives most tint decisions. Long, hot summers push interior temperatures into uncomfortable ranges within minutes when a vehicle sits in a parking lot, and UV exposure accelerates fading on dashboards, seats, and door panels. Quality window tint blocks a significant portion of the heat and nearly all the UV, which extends the life of interior materials and improves comfort every time someone opens the door.
Privacy and security drive another set of installs. Vehicle owners often want privacy for personal items visible through rear windows or protection from prying eyes at stoplights and parking areas. Home and business owners choose tint to reduce visibility into offices, retail spaces, and residential rooms, especially those facing busy streets or nearby buildings. The right tint level balances privacy with visibility while keeping the finished look clean.
Glare reduction and safety round out the drivers. Bright morning and evening sun can create dangerous glare during commutes, and workspace glare on computer monitors reduces productivity in office and retail environments.
